To permit this type of usage, add the concept of devfreq providers. Devfreq providers for panthor register themselves with panthor as a provider. panthor then gets whatever driver is suckling on its performance-node property, finds the registered devfreq provider init function for it, and calls it. Should the probe order work out such that panthor probes before the devfreq provider is finished probing and registering itself, then we just defer the probe after adding a device link.
